Output 24a9d217990493f9868107b3b6fa8cf16cff17675ba9d285db519184726184d4:0

value
644000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f05b7d647945ce298f3fe8d3ba9586d30f3f701 OP_EQUAL
address
3K73qV5HKCYeTEkaeum3gh7R4MawPkxmD5
transaction
24a9d217990493f9868107b3b6fa8cf16cff17675ba9d285db519184726184d4
confirmations
429396
spent
true